Figure above shows a typical queuing system in a communication network that receives information in the form of packets. Packets arrive at the input port from various information sources at different times. The queuing system has one or more servers, and the service time of a packet depends on the size of the packet and also some random factors. After the packet is processed, it will be forwarded to the output port to be transmitted to the next destination. If all the servers are busy, then the arriving packet will be put in a buffer where it waits until a server becomes available. Since the size of the buffer is finite, packets that arrive when the buffer is fully occupied will be rejected.

The given system can be represented using mathematical model for the ease of system analysis and design.

b) Demonstrate how Markov chain can be used to model and analyse the queuing process of packets in the buffer.
